Built on Grit. Driven by Community.
The ROY Garage started in 2020 with a blue-collar mindset and a commitment to authenticity. We don't care about perfection—we care about uniqueness and consistency. Big builds and major life changes happen when you just keep showing up to the workbench, even when it’s not easy.
Through our automotive YouTube channel and our line of premium, heavy-duty shop gear and apparel, we are building a community of builders, fabricators, and DIY enthusiasts who aren't afraid to get their hands dirty and build something meaningful.
